‘Cautious budget’ for tough economic times

Business

 

Labor’s first budget stuck to its election campaign script but offered only glimpses of a holistic vision and no surprises, says CPA Australia senior policy manager Gavan Ord.

By Philip King 8 minute read

Speaking on the latest Accountants Daily podcast, Mr Ord said it was a “cautious budget that suits the tough economic environment” with glimpses of future ambition in the areas of housing, manufacturing, and climate change.

“The Treasury made it clear this budget was about just delivering on its election promises. This was really just a reprioritising of government spending towards its election commitments.

“So it wasn’t a traditional budget, there weren’t really any surprises.”
